The tariff classification of wall clock from Thailand
NY J86924 August 26, 2003 CLA-2-91:RR:NC:MM:114 J86924 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 9105.21.80 Mr. Jerry T. Ficke Associated Premium Corporation 1870 Summit Road Cincinnati, OH 45237 RE: The tariff classification of wall clock from Thailand Dear Mr. Ficke: In your letter dated July 23, 2003, you requested a tariff classification ruling on a wall clock from Thailand. A sample of the wall clock was submitted with the ruling request. The sample for which you are requesting a classification is an analog wall clock with a quartz battery powered movement. There is no item number stated in your request. There are no jewels in the movement. The clock is housed in a round plastic case and has a round dial with black hour and minute hands, and a red second hand. The clock has a silver colored frame. The face of the clock features the traditional Arabic numerals 1 through 12 around the periphery corresponding to the hours of the day. The face of the clock features a depiction of jockeys racing their horses at Saratoga Racetrack. The name “Saratoga” is printed in the upper portion of the face of the clock. The words “America’s Racetrack” are printed directly below the name “Saratoga”. You have indicated in your letter that the intended use for the wall clock is as a giveaway at sporting events. The wall clock measures approximately 11¼ inches in height, 11¼ inches in length and 1½ inches in width. The clock measures approximately 9½ inches in diameter. On the back of the plastic housing is an opening for changing the battery. The clock requires one AA battery to operate. The battery is included. The clock is packaged in a cardboard box ready for retail sale. You have suggested classification for the wall clock under 9105.29.4000,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for other clocks; wall clocks; other than electrically operated. We disagree with your proposed classification because the submitted quartz battery powered wall clock is electrically operated. The applicable subheading for the wall clock will be 9105.21.80, HTS, which provides for other clocks; wall clocks; electrically operated; other. The rate of duty will be 30 cents each plus 6.9 percent ad valorem on the case plus 5.3 percent ad valorem on the battery.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
